Cybersecurity Engineer Jobs in Amman, Jordan at Avertra

Role Overview

The Cybersecurity Engineer is a senior technical role responsible for implementing and evolving Avertra’s IT security framework across our cloud-native infrastructure and application landscape. You will protect the organization’s systems, data, and operations while maintaining continuous compliance with industry and regulatory standards.

​Key Responsibilities

Threat Detection & Incident Response

  • Conduct continuous network monitoring and intrusion detection using IDS/IPS, SIEM, NAC, HBSS, and vulnerability management tooling.
  • Correlate activity across networks, applications, and systems to identify unauthorized access patterns, trends, and emerging attack vectors.
  • Triage and document security alerts; produce formal incident reports with actionable remediation steps.
  • Research emerging threats and CVEs; assess applicability and risk to the organization.

Vulnerability & Configuration Management

  • Plan, execute, and manage enterprise vulnerability scans across cloud infrastructure, containers, and application layers.
  • Identify and resolve false positives; perform compensating controls analysis and validate control efficacy.
  • Enforce configuration and hardening standards across compute, networking, and application environments.
  • Produce vulnerability, configuration, and coverage metrics to demonstrate assessment coverage and remediation effectiveness.

Security Engineering & Controls

  • Implement and maintain security controls across cloud infrastructure, identity management, and application layers.
  • Integrate security tooling into development and deployment pipelines to enable a secure-by-default engineering culture.
  • Recommend and implement security controls and corrective actions to mitigate technical and business risk.
  • Develop and enforce security standards across systems, software, and networking components.

Compliance & Governance (SOC 1/2 · PCI DSS)

  • Act as the primary point of contact for SOC 1, SOC 2, and PCI DSS audit engagements.
  • Design and maintain compliance controls, gather evidence, and drive audit readiness across all trust service criteria.
  • Scope and segment the PCI Cardholder Data Environment (CDE) and ensure appropriate network segmentation.
  • Manage audit trails, access reviews, change management procedures, and data classification policies.
  • Establish and govern the IT risk and compliance framework; manage third-party and vendor risk.
  • Recommend improvements to the Information Security Program, reporting findings to the Information Security Officer.

Reporting & Policy

  • Generate executive-ready reports on assessment findings and summarize to facilitate remediation across teams.
  • Manage and maintain security policies and procedures organization-wide.
  • Perform periodic security and compliance-related reviews and audits.
